Abstract

The utility model discloses a shielding structure for a pocket door and the pocket door, wherein, the shielding structure comprises a fixed plate and a decorative plate, the fixed plate is used for being fixed with a wall body which is provided with a door leaf containing space; the decorative board is used for dismantling with the fixed plate and is connected, and the decorative board is used for shielding the clearance between storage space and the door leaf. The utility model has the advantages that through the detachable connection of the fixed plate and the decorative plate, the decorative plate can select different sizes according to actual needs, adapt to the gaps between different door leaves and the accommodating space of the wall body, and the decorative plate can block dust and sundries to prevent the dust and the sundries from entering the accommodating space; in addition, the decorative board shields the gap between the door leaf and the containing space and can also play a role in shielding beauty.

Background
The pocket door refers to a door leaf which can move relative to the ground and can be hidden in the space in the wall. With the rise of living cost, pocket doors are becoming more popular in the market due to the feature of saving storage space.
The pocket door can be a single door leaf or a plurality of door leaves. No matter the pocket door of single door leaf or many door leaves, all need all pass through the door slot that supplies the door leaf to hide in the installation in the wall body reservation. However, the door slot of the existing pocket door is usually open, so that dust and sundries are easy to enter the door slot and deposit in the door slot during use, which hinders the movement of the door leaf and affects the normal use of the pocket door.

Referring to fig. 1, the present invention provides a pocket door 10, the pocket door 10 is installed on the wall body, and can be hidden or exposed in the storage space of the wall body, so that the pocket door 10 can be switched between the door opening state and the door closing state. The utility model discloses a pocket door 10 can also shield the storage space of wall body, prevents that dust and debris from getting into the storage space of wall body, alleviates the pressure of cleaning of storage space in the wall body.
Specifically, the pocket door 10 includes a sliding component (not shown), a door leaf component 100 and a shielding structure 200, the sliding component is used for being movably disposed on a track, and the sliding component may be a pulley, a slider and other components capable of realizing movable connection;
the door leaf assembly 100 includes at least one door leaf 110, and the door leaf 110 can be switched between a door opening state hidden in the wall body accommodating space and a door closing state exposed in the wall body accommodating space under the guidance of the sliding assembly;
the shielding structure 200 can be fixed on a wall on at least one side of the door leaf 110, and the shielding structure 200 is used for shielding a gap between the door leaf 110 and the receiving space. It should be noted that the shielding mechanism 200 can shield the gap between the door leaf 100 and the receiving space, and the shielding mechanism 200 can partially or completely shield the gap between the door leaf 110 and one side of the receiving space; the shielding structure 200 may be configured to partially or completely shield a gap between the door leaf 110 and the opposite sides of the receiving space.
When the pocket door 10 is actually installed, there is an error in construction, which causes a difference in the size of the opening of the receiving space in the wall, so that the size applicability of the shielding structure 200 is deteriorated, and the shielding effect is further easily affected. To solve this problem, referring to fig. 2, in an embodiment, the shielding structure 200 includes a fixing plate 210 and a decorative plate 220, the fixing plate 210 is used for fixing to a wall body formed with a receiving space of the door leaf 110, the decorative plate 220 is used for detachably connecting to the fixing plate 210, and the decorative plate 220 is used for shielding a gap between the door leaf and the receiving space. The size of decorative board 220 can be selected according to the clearance size between door leaf subassembly 100 and the wall body, so sets up, and fixed plate 210 can set up to the same size in actual production, and the not unidimensional decorative board 220 of collocation realizes shielding again during the installation, can enough guarantee that fixed plate 210 can set up single size, be convenient for produce, also can be applicable to the wall body of multiple not unidimensional and accomodate the space opening.
The utility model provides a shielding structure 200 for pocket door, through the detachable connection of fixed plate 210 and decorative board 220, decorative board 220 can select different sizes according to actual need, adapts to the clearance of different door leaves 110 and wall body accommodating space, and decorative board 220 can form the barrier to dust and debris, prevents dust and debris from getting into accommodating space; in addition, the decorative plate 220 can also play a role in blocking the gap between the door leaf and the storage space and beautifying the appearance.
In an embodiment, the fixing plate 210 is provided with one of an elastic rubber strip 211 and a locking groove 221, the decorative plate 220 is provided with the other of the elastic rubber strip 211 and the locking groove 221, the elastic rubber strip 211 can elastically deform to extend into or separate from the locking groove 221, and the elastic rubber strip 211 can also be fixed to the locking groove 221 by restoring the deformation, so that the decorative plate 220 and the fixing plate 210 are relatively fixed.
In one embodiment, the pocket door 10 further comprises a sealing member 230, the sealing member 230 is connected to the decorative plate 220, and a side of the sealing member 230 facing away from the decorative plate 220 is provided with a wool top 231, and the wool top 231 faces the door leaf 110.
With continued reference to fig. 1, in one embodiment, the door leaf is provided with a shielding member 140, and the shielding member 140 is configured to cooperate with the decorative plate 220 to shield a gap between the door leaf 110 and the receiving space when the door leaf 110 is in the door-opened state and/or the door-closed state. It should be noted that the decorative plate 220 and the shielding member 140 may be matched such that the decorative plate 220 abuts against the shielding member 140, thereby completely shielding the gap between the door leaf 110 and the receiving space; the decorative plate 220 and the shielding member 140 may not directly abut against each other, and the shielding member 140 may be stacked on the decorative plate 220 in the moving direction of the door leaf 110, so that the shielding member 140 may prevent dust and foreign matter from entering the storage space in the wall body in the moving direction of the door leaf 110. The covering 140 cooperates with the trim panel 220 to further enhance the sealing of the door leaf 110 in the open and/or closed door positions.
In an embodiment, the shielding member 140 includes a first shielding member 141 and a second shielding member 142, the first shielding member 141 and the second shielding member 142 are respectively disposed at least one end portion of the door leaf 110, the end portions are opposite ends of the door leaf 110 in a moving direction thereof, and the first shielding member 141 and the second shielding member 142 are respectively used for shielding gaps located at opposite sides of the door leaf 110. By arranging the first shielding member 141 and the second shielding member 142 at opposite sides of the end portion of the door leaf 110, the first shielding member 141 and the second shielding member 142 can respectively shield gaps at opposite sides of the door leaf and the accommodating space in the door opening state and/or the door closing state of the door leaf 110, thereby improving the overall sealing property.
